Hi, an update on the issue of upgrading Fedora 19 to Fedora 20 for FreeIPA deployments.
An updated 389-ds-base package, 1.3.2.9-1.fc20 is in updates-testing repository. Updated slapi-nis package, 0.52-1.fc20, is in updates-testing as well. I've tested that using fedora-upgrade tool to upgrade from Fedora 19 to Fedora 20 does work if you have updates-testing repository enabled and that FreeIPA is continuing to work afterwards. I've initiated move of 389-ds-base to updates stable repository. Once it reach out there, I'll lift a warning on freeipa.org and publish a final update.
